For my project, I decided to make a Thanksgiving-themed pillow box. I took a pillow box and made a few alterations, including the addition of an Elegant Edges window. Once the box was cut, I embossed it with a basketweave folder. I used a few metal dies to create my leaf spray. The maple and oak leaves are from the NEW Fall Border metal die set, the brown leaves from the Flowers - Daisy set and the swirls from the NEW Fall Wheelbarrow set.
The little ticket was cut using a Tickets metal die and the border and underline were stamped using Tickets stamps. The wonderful sentiment is from the NEW Fall Leaves stamp set.
I finished everything off with some Bittersweet jute string and a brass brad. Oh! Plus I wrapped some tiny Hershey chocolate bars and decorated them with leaves cut using the NEW Fall Border metal dies before tucking them into the box.
